I suppose when you buy a house there will always be surprises. We are trying to manage them. Like the Asian ladybugs. A musty smell in one bedroom. A frustrating oven. A toilet that has caused floor damage. Windows that are, let's just say old. Not related to the house but related to the move, planning for the likely school change next year (I am not doing well with this). And, completely unrelated to the move, a computer crashing.
Despite the troubles, we are loving the place.
I get to cook and clean in a kitchen that is open and sunny and looks out over the beautiful back yard. I get to have a friend over for each child and not feel overwhelmed because of the tight space. We can lay out homework on the dining-room table (currently a fold up card table) and not have to put it away in order to set the table for dinner. We have a whole room for the computer, which means my bedroom isn't a partial office. I will get to set up my sewing machine next to the computer (they have great chemistry) and it can be accessible always! This means pants get fixed and much more quickly! Rejoice! Our storage unit (aka "my summer home") no longer holds our extras...our basement does. Tool boxes go in the garage, not the kids' closet. A piano in the living room, not a bedroom. The list goes on!
It's been a whirlwind experience buying a home, moving in, setting up. I'm ready to finish the organizing and settle in so that it's only "regular" life to worry about. But I don't know...as my friend's blog title says, maybe "crazy is the new normal." I wouldn't be surprised!

Update. So you can sleep better. Honestly not more than 10 minutes after I posted about the odd smell in the house Daniel called with good news. As he was looking for the filter in the furnace he came across an open box of MOTH BALLS. That smell was permeating the entire house!! It was horrible! He told me that as soon as he took it out there was a noticeable improvement in the house's smell! Why on earth would anyone have those things!? Anyway, we are both incredibly relieved as the smell was nauseating. (We still have the occasional area with its own scent, but I figure those will fade in time.) So now if you are with me and I have an odor, well, I have a problem.
